Jordan - Public credit registry coverage
Public credit registry coverage (% of adults)
Public credit registry coverage (% of adults) in Jordan was 1.60 as of 2011. Its highest value over the past 7 years was 1.60 in 2011, while its lowest value was 0.50 in 2004.
Definition: Public credit registry coverage reports the number of individuals and firms listed in a public credit registry with current information on repayment history, unpaid debts, or credit outstanding. The number is expressed as a percentage of the adult population.
Source: World Bank, Doing Business project (http://www.doingbusiness.org/).
